We think we've found something that looks like a bug. 
In the minimal file test_A.xqm, we declare a default namespace and a function with a very simple path annotation (without variable). It works just fine. 
In test_B.xqm, we just declare a function with a variable in its path annotation. This is OK as well. 
In test_C.xqm, we declare both a default namespace and a path annotation with a variable. This raises a NullPointerException as you can see in error.html (which also provide version number informations).

The choice between variables in path annotation and default element namespace is a difficult one! We'd like to use them both! Or are we missing something ?
